What is Geomagic for SolidWorks?
Geomagic for SolidWorks is a software solution that combines the power of 3D scanning with the robust CAD capabilities of SolidWorks. It enables users to import 3D scan data directly into SolidWorks, where they can then use powerful tools to process, analyze, and modify the data to create precise CAD models. This seamless integration facilitates a more efficient workflow, eliminating the need for manual data translation and minimizing the risk of data corruption or loss.

What is Geomagic for SolidWorks?
Geomagic for SolidWorks is a software add-in that allows users to work with 3D scan data directly within the SolidWorks environment. It provides a range of tools for processing and editing scan data, including point cloud processing, surface creation, and mesh refinement. The software is designed to help users create accurate and detailed 3D models from scanned data, which can be used for a variety of applications such as reverse engineering, quality control, and product design.

Geomagic for SOLIDWORKS is an integrated Scan-to-CAD software solution designed to streamline reverse engineering by allowing users to scan directly into the SOLIDWORKS environment. Core Capabilities & Performance
Reviewers frequently highlight its ability to transform "noisy" scan data into usable, feature-based parametric models .
Speed: In benchmarks, Geomagic has been shown to be significantly faster—up to 485% faster—than standard add-ins like ScanTo3D when converting mesh data into solid objects.
Accuracy: It includes a Deviation Analysis tool that provides real-time feedback on how closely your CAD model matches the original scan data.
Workflow: It offers tools for region grouping, automatic and guided feature extraction (extrusions, revolutions), and "exact surfacing" for organic shapes. Community Perspectives

Using a "crack" or "patched" version of Geomagic for SOLIDWORKS—a professional-grade scan-to-CAD software—carries serious risks that often outweigh the perceived benefit of avoiding license costs. The Risks of Using Cracked Software
Security Vulnerabilities: Patched installers from unofficial sources are common delivery methods for malware, ransomware, and spyware that can compromise your entire network.
Software Instability: Cracks often break the deep integration between Geomagic and SOLIDWORKS, leading to frequent crashes, data corruption, or the inability to save complex mesh-to-CAD conversions.
Legal and Professional Liability: For businesses, using unlicensed software can lead to heavy fines, legal action from Oqton/3D Systems, and the loss of professional certifications.
No Technical Support or Updates: You lose access to critical bug fixes, new scanner hardware drivers, and the official support desk which is vital for troubleshooting complex reverse-engineering workflows. Legitimate Ways to Access Geomagic
If you need the software for professional or educational use, consider these safer alternatives:
Free Trial: You can request a Free Trial of Geomagic for SOLIDWORKS directly from the developer to test its capabilities on your specific project.
Educational Licenses: Students and faculty can often access heavily discounted versions through their university's engineering department.
Subscription Models: Rather than a large upfront cost, many resellers offer subscription-based pricing to help manage cash flow for shorter projects. Recommended Alternatives
If the official cost is prohibitive, there are other scan-to-CAD tools with different pricing structures:
SOLIDWORKS Built-in Tools: Use the native "ScanTo3D" add-in (available in SOLIDWORKS Professional and Premium) for basic mesh handling.
MeshLab (Open Source): For cleaning and processing mesh data before importing it into SOLIDWORKS.
Quicksurface: Often cited by users on Reddit and CAD forums as a more budget-friendly (yet professional) alternative for reverse engineering. Geomagic For Solidworks Crack Patched Fix
